Transaction 3a43376a66b1647ede72b3a9236164ced4c580b51eec2e7810797550d9600b2a

2 Input
2 Outputs
  • 3a43376a66b1647ede72b3a9236164ced4c580b51eec2e7810797550d9600b2a:0
  • value  1082914
    address  1HhdZbByzSLExD6uN12heBZXD3BCaQivfe
  • 3a43376a66b1647ede72b3a9236164ced4c580b51eec2e7810797550d9600b2a:1
  • value  2500000
    address  1622EC6uz7hcBAz4vu7ogTsePXmAd8Po4W